For dog-friendly off the beaten path attractions near Delhi, consider visiting the Neemrana Fort Palace. This architectural marvel nestled in the Aravalli hills offers stunning views and allows dogs on the premises. Another hidden gem is the scenic hill station of Lansdowne, where you can enjoy long walks with your furry friend amidst pine forests and visit the tranquil Bhulla Lake. Locals also love the Barog Tunnel, a lesser-known spot near Kasauli, known for its historical significance and breathtaking views. Remember to check with the local authorities regarding dog-friendly policies and leash requirements.
